Some homes are designed to impose themselves on their surroundings. This one does exactly the opposite.

Conceived as a piece of architecture integrated into the hillside, the residence extends horizontally through mature vegetation, stone, concrete and expansive planes of glass, allowing the landscape to become a permanent part of the interiors.

The architecture is deliberately serene. Clean lines, flat roofs and a natural material palette create a contemporary aesthetic free from excess. Inside, wood brings warmth to a neutral composition of stone and soft tones, while floor-to-ceiling windows open the principal living spaces towards the mountains and the Mediterranean.

The home is arranged across several levels, all connected by lift, making movement throughout the property exceptionally comfortable. Two bedrooms are located on the intermediate level and a further two on the upper floor, all with en-suite bathrooms, creating a well-balanced layout that offers privacy and independence for both family and guests.

The main living area is conceived as a sequence of connected spaces. Living room, dining area and kitchen flow naturally into one another while retaining their own identity, defined by bespoke joinery and a carefully considered selection of materials. The kitchen is spacious yet understated, following the same architectural language as the rest of the home: natural wood, light surfaces and a constant connection to the outdoors.

The bedrooms continue this sense of calm. Generous proportions, abundant natural light and expansive glazing allow the views to become part of each room. The principal suite feels almost like a private retreat, with bespoke carpentry, a particularly serene atmosphere and a bathroom where stone, wood and metal come together with precision.

It is outdoors, however, where the architecture reveals its full dimension.

A substantial covered terrace extends the living spaces into the landscape, creating distinct areas for dining, relaxing and entertaining. Natural stone and exposed concrete reinforce the organic character of the design, while the pool appears suspended above the valley, its line of water seeming to merge with the mountains beyond.

Seen from above, the concept becomes especially clear: a low-slung residence almost hidden among ‌the ‌vegetation, ‌designed ‌more ‌to belong to ‌the landscape ‌than ‌to ‌stand ‌apart from ‌it.
